The Outbreak Unfolds

In November 2025, Ethiopia's Ministry of Health declared an outbreak of MVD in the South Ethiopia Regional State, following laboratory confirmation of suspected viral hemorrhagic fever cases in Jinka town. The first known case was an adult who developed symptoms on October 23, 2025, and sought treatment at the General Hospital the next day. As the disease spread, it claimed 14 confirmed lives and five probable ones, with a staggering 64.3% case fatality rate. But how did this happen, and what can we learn from Ethiopia's experience?

A Race Against Time

As the outbreak unfolded, local and national health authorities sprang into action, implementing a range of public health measures. A National Taskforce was established to provide strategic guidance, while a three-month response plan was developed and launched. Community surveillance, contact tracing, and house-to-house visits were enhanced, and two hospitals were designated as treatment centers. The Human Cost and the Road to Recovery

The outbreak took a heavy toll on affected communities, with 19 confirmed and probable cases reported. However, the tireless efforts of healthcare workers, community health teams, and international partners paid off. On January 26, 2026, Ethiopia declared the end of the MVD outbreak, following two consecutive incubation periods without new confirmed cases. But the story doesn't end here. The risk of re-emergence remains, and the country is now focused on maintaining early detection and care capacities, as well as raising awareness about risk factors and protective measures.
